Typically eaten at lunch, Peruvian ceviche is a light and refreshing dish with a flurry of flavours and textures. Sustainable sea bass in classic leche de tigre, with a pop of Andean corn and crunch from the cancha corn nuts.

Although South America has a reputation as a meat-eaters paradise, like many places in the world, veganism is on the rise in Peru. On this World Vegan Day, why not try something new? Opt for a Aubergine tacu tacu, a Palm Heart Ceviche or a Beetroot Causa
